  1. Is there a difference in the capturing capabilities of the 7500, 8500 end the 9000 models, or is the difference only in 3D performance?
    Quote Quote  
  2. Capture abilities are identical. The 7000 and 8000 series use the same theatre chip as my AIW Radeon 32 DDR board.

    Better off (if you don't need the game graphics) to try and find an AIW Radeon 32 DDR like mine....

  3. Is the Radeon AIW better then the pci TV Wonder for capturing ?
    Quote Quote  
  4. YES!!!

    ATI's TVwonder is using a different capture chip - not as crisp, lower over-all resolution.

    AIW-128 and Radeon use a newer theatre chip. Much better captures (I have both, and the Radeon wins hands down.)

  5. What chip is the newer Radeon's using ?
    The reason I asked is I justed poised the same query to a local pc hardware vendor and he told me there was no difference and to save my money. He also lost a sale, so I'm confussed ....

    Thanks
    Quote Quote  
  6. The 7500, 8550 AIW uses the Rage Theater 1 chip and the Micronas stereo decoder, the 9700 PRO uses the Theater 200, as for the 8500Dv capture digitally the 9700Pro does not, not big deal also the 9700Pro takes the burden off the CPU by utilizing R300 graphics chip to do most of the encoding and stuff.
